This is more of a general question regarding LR. My development team wants a log of all the communications between the client and the server. The replay log contains only the client side actions. If I turn on the "data returned by server", I'm getting such voluminous data, that I'm sure nobody has time to sift through it.

I'm looking for a document that contains the requests made by the client and the HTTP response of the server.

Can someone point me in the right direction?
